Output ebaf1e31a0d7fb0e49d85109187b2097c9a240c672048b69cccb1a1e9a536fc1:0

value
11693124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ff99e23710305823db4fe3e45cb90ff03763a48e OP_EQUAL
address
3QzWaV2uySB4ydTvghjkRJZd8BX2SrTuP1
transaction
ebaf1e31a0d7fb0e49d85109187b2097c9a240c672048b69cccb1a1e9a536fc1
confirmations
428251
spent
true